Another person arrested over forcible entry to President’s House

 

A suspect has been arrested in connection with the forcible entry into the President’s House in Colombo and obstructing the duties of police officers. 


The 32-year-old suspect, who is residing in the Koswatte area, was arrested on charges of engaging in a demonstration by being a member of an unlawful assembly at Bank of Ceylon Mawatha in Colombo Fort, damaging public property and criminal coercion by obstructing the duties of police officers on July 09.
